Composite skin

The skin is a stressed component that covers the outside of the aircraft skeleton, and with the development of the aircraft industry, the demand for carbon fiber processing will increase. The material of the fuselage skin workpiece is high-strength carbon fiber, which has the characteristics of high strength, light weight and difficult processing, and special tools are required to meet the processing needs in the processing process.

SD200

Suitable for side and slot milling of aerospace Carbon fiber composite materials
Using diamond coating to improve tool life
The left and right interleaved edge design can effectively suppress the flanging and delamination of the workpiece
